Four men have been arrested in connection with the killing of a man outside a Hollywood restaurant during a “follow-home” robbery, a trend of stick-ups in and around Los Angeles that have increased and sometimes turned violent, authorities said Friday.
The Los Angeles County District Attorney's Office has filed charges against Sanders, Castillo and Singleton for murder, robbery and attempted robbery, the LAPD said. Saulsberry is charged with robbery.
The arrests stem from the Nov. 23 killing of Jose Ruiz Gutierrez, 23, outside the Bossa Nova restaurant, KCBS-TV reported. Gutierrez was coming to the aid of a woman who was allegedly being robbed when he was fatally shot.
